Things I Didn't Throw Out (Script error: The function "langx" does not exist.) is a 2017 Polish essay collection and memoir by Polish writer and graphic designer Marcin Wicha.

The book won the Nike Literary Award in 2018,[1] and it was also associated with major Polish literary honours including the Paszport Polityki for literature and the Witold Gombrowicz Literary Award.[2]

Review and reception

Reviewing the English translation, The Arts Desk described the book as making sense of personal and political history through the material remnants of everyday life.[3]

The Big Issue characterised the memoir as both humorous and serious in its portrait of Wicha's mother and the social history surrounding her life.[4]
